Job 21:12
King James Version
“They take the timbrel and harp, and rejoice at the sound of the organ.”
Context
9Their houses safe from fear, neither the rod of God upon them.
10Their bull gendereth, and faileth not; their cow calveth, and casteth not her calf.
11They send forth their little ones like a flock, and their children dance.
12They take the timbrel and harp, and rejoice at the sound of the organ.
13They spend their days in wealth, and in a moment go down to the grave.
14Therefore they say unto God, Depart from us; for we desire not the knowledge of thy ways.
15What the Almighty, that we should serve him? and what profit should we have, if we pray unto him?
